CYBERKNIFE IN THE TREATMENT OF PROSTATE CANCER: A REVOLUTIONARY SYSTEM
MORGIA, Giuseppe;DE RENZIS, Costantino
2009-01-01
Abstract
The CyberKnife is a frameless advanced robotic system that uses image-guided radiotherapy (IGRT) and adaptive radiotherapy (ART) for stereotactic radiosurgery technique in intra- and extracranial lesions. The CyberKnife has also revolutionised the use of radiosurgery to treat tumours in different parts of the body.
